Christopher Quadflieg

Senior Frontend Developer at Paperless

Hamburg, Germany
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Christopher Quadflieg is a Senior Frontend Developer based in Hamburg with 10 years of experience building polished Vue 3 + TypeScript user interfaces and Material Design-driven products. He pairs a front-end focus with full-stack and database competence—contributing to projects from Vite and VueUse to node-pg-migrate—showing comfort with Node.js, PostgreSQL migrations, and type-safe ecosystems. A passionate TypeScript advocate, he has helped modernize well-known open-source projects (including DefinitelyTyped and Vite) by adding types, improving tooling and CI, and migrating codebases to TypeScript. Christopher prefers technically modern stacks (Vue 3 + TypeScript frontends, GraphQL, and Node/Kotlin/Rust backends) and values healthy work-life balance, including generous vacation and hybrid work. Not obvious at first glance: beyond UI polish he actively improves developer ergonomics—linting, prettier, CI fixes—that keep teams shipping consistently.
code10 years of coding experience
job8 years of employment as a software developer
bookFachinformatiker Anwendungsentwicklung, Fachinformatiker Anwendungsentwicklung at Berufskolleg für Wirtschaft und Verwaltung Aachen
languagesGerman, English
stackoverflow-logo

Stackoverflow

Stats
655reputation
65kreached
23answers
10questions
github-logo-circle

Github Skills (54)

database-migrations10
javascript10
utilities10
postgresql10
mastodon-app10
testing10
css10
databases10
typescript10
dev-server10
typescript-definitions10
vite10
nuxt10
eslint10
ui-design10

Programming languages (22)

C#PowerShellMDXJavaC++CSSRustC

Github contributions (5)

github-logo-circle
faker-js/faker

Jan 2022 - Jan 2023

Generate massive amounts of fake data in the browser and node.js
Role in this project:
userFull-stack Developer
Contributions:28 releases, 3742 reviews, 288 commits in 1 year
Contributions summary:Christopher's contributions primarily involved migrating and restructuring existing JavaScript code from a previous version of the Faker library to TypeScript. The commits encompass a wide array of refactoring tasks, including migrating core modules such as system, internet, fake, address, lorem, commerce, phone, image, vehicle, git, music, unique, date, and finance. In addition to the code migration, the user also addressed build configurations, added type declarations, implemented improved linting, and ensured the code's functionality and consistency. This suggests a broad understanding of the project's codebase and a dedication to modernizing its underlying architecture and improving maintainability.
databrowseramountstestingjavascript
htmlhint/HTMLHint

Aug 2018 - May 2021

⚙️ The static code analysis tool you need for your HTML
Role in this project:
userFull-stack Developer
Contributions:3 releases, 92 commits, 96 PRs in 2 years 9 months
Contributions summary:Christopher primarily focused on improving the code quality and maintainability of the HTMLHint project. Their contributions include translating comments, removing license headers, and improving code readability. They also implemented fixes related to link functionalities and formatted test files. Additionally, the user modernized the codebase by converting to TypeScript and applying linting rules.
linterhtmlhintanalysisjavascriptstatic-code-analysis
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Christopher Quadflieg - Senior Frontend Developer at Paperless